What companies run services between Canary Wharf (Station), England and Holborn, England?

Elizabeth Line (TfL) operates a train from Canary Wharf to Farringdon Without every 10 minutes. Tickets cost £2–6 and the journey takes 9 min. Alternatively, Stagecoach London operates a bus from Canary Wharf station to Chancery Lane hourly. Tickets cost £2 and the journey takes 26 min. Centaur Coaches also services this route every 3 hours.
